Umra
Umra is a village located in Khamgaon tehsil of Buldana district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Khamgaon (tehsildar office) and 75km away from district headquarter Buldana. As per 2009 stats, Hiwarkhd is the gram panchayat of Umra village.

About Umra
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Umra is 528792. The village spans a total geographical area of 777.6 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 444308. Khamgaon is nearest town to Umra village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Umra
Below is a concise population overview of Umra as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,047 | 538 | 509 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 160 | 87 | 73 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 302 | 160 | 142 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 9 | 5 | 4 |
Literate Population | 623 | 357 | 266 |
Illiterate Population | 424 | 181 | 243 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Umra village:
- The total population of Umra village is around 1,047, including approximately 538 males and 509 females, with a sex ratio of 946 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 160 children aged 0–6 years in Umra village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Umra village has 302 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 9 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Umra village is about 59.50%, with male literacy at 66.36% and female literacy at 52.26%.
- There are around 246 households in Umra village.
Connectivity of Umra
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Umra. As per the 2011 stats, Umra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
